Extreme E races at the Jurassic X Prix in England for inaugural season finale

Extreme E is back this weekend for the fifth and final race of its inaugural season, this time on the Jurassic Coast in southern England. Each Extreme E venue is picked to bring awareness to one aspect of environmental damage humans are doing to the Earth.
